Income Limits in Cochrane, Wisconsin. Buffalo County, WI Income Limits Summary*
Income Limit Area Buffalo County
Median Income $85,900
Income Limit Category Very Low (50%) Income Limits Extremely Low Income Limits
Person(s) In Family 1 $30,350 $18,200
2 $34,650 $20,800
3 $39,000 $23,400
4 $43,300 $26,000
5 $46,800 $28,080

* Important: Your income, and income limit category, is needed to apply to most of the apartments on our list.
